Compare all specifications:
2004 Alpina B3 | 1999 Porsche 911 | |
Make | Alpina | Porsche |
Model | B3 | 911 |
Year Released | 2004 | 1999 |
Body Type | Sedan | Coupe |
Engine Position | Front | Rear |
Engine Size | 3346 cc | 3387 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 6 cylinders | 6 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| boxer |
Valves per Cylinder | 4 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 301 HP | 296 HP |
Engine RPM | 6300 RPM | 6000 RPM |
Torque | 362 Nm | 350 Nm |
Engine Compression Ratio | 10.0:1 | 11.3:1 |
Top Speed | 270 km/hour | 260 km/hour |
Drive Type | Rear | 4WD |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 2 seats |
Number of Doors | 4 doors | 2 doors |
Vehicle Length | 4480 mm | 4440 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1750 mm | 1770 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1400 mm | 1320 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2730 mm | 2360 mm |
